How they compare
Burkina Faso currently reports 818.00 million against 705.70 million in Angola, a difference of 112.30 million.
That makes Burkina Faso's figure about 1.2 times Angola's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 36 shared years of data; in 1987 it was Angola ahead.
Angola ranks 125th and Burkina Faso ranks 122nd of 181 countries.
Across the 5 decades both report, Angola averaged higher in 2 and Burkina Faso in 3.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Angola | Burkina Faso |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1980s | 492.34 million | 326.84 million | 165.50 million | Angola |
| 1990s | 572.54 million | 445.38 million | 127.16 million | Angola |
| 2000s | 686.11 million | 767.00 million | 80.89 million | Burkina Faso |
| 2010s | 705.70 million | 818.00 million | 112.30 million | Burkina Faso |
| 2020s | 705.70 million | 818.00 million | 112.30 million | Burkina Faso |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
